Output e8cfc5917a2107fea4e9b6bc8f53f02b3c9d64accbec8d6bfe333b2094ee793a:1

value
16434144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b50183df4766943058201f6fdddbbaea9e2d350 OP_EQUAL
address
MN4NvEvdukERZp3JZsHGq5EzLtdFkPC23e
transaction
e8cfc5917a2107fea4e9b6bc8f53f02b3c9d64accbec8d6bfe333b2094ee793a
spent
true